A healthy diet can tip the scales against chronic pain

One in five 鈥 or 1.6 million 鈥 Australians struggle with chronic pain, an acute and debilitating condition. Globally, the figure is higher, at around 30% of the population, with higher rates among women and people who are overweight or obese. But there鈥檚 an easy and accessible way for sufferers of chronic pain to reduce its severity, from the has shown.

By exploring associations between body fat, diet and pain, researchers found that a greater consumption of foods within the was directly associated with lower levels of body pain, particularly among women. Notably, these findings were independent of a person鈥檚 weight. This means that a healthy diet can help reduce chronic pain, regardless of body composition.

鈥淚t鈥檚 common knowledge that eating well is good for your health and wellbeing. But knowing that simple changes to your diet could offset chronic pain, could be lifechanging,鈥 one of the researchers, Sue Ward, said. 鈥淚n our study, higher consumption of core foods 鈥 which are your vegetables, fruits, grains, lean meats, dairy and alternatives 鈥 was related to less pain, and this was regardless of body weight.鈥

鈥楤etter diet quality is associated with reduced body pain in adults regardless of adiposity: findings from the Whyalla Intergenerational Study of Health鈥, a 2024 paper on this study, has been published open access in Nutrition Research and you can read it at .
